Tony Wright AKA VerseChorusVerse's debut long player will hit the shelves (physical and digital shelves, that is) on April 7th and it's been a long wait for both the musician and fans alike. The Northern Irishman has been a fixture on the Irish music scene for many a year now, in various capacities, and a listen to 'No More Years' will confirm that this has been worth the wait.

The self-titled record was recorded under the tutelage of Iain Archer, the man partially responsible for this Jake Bugg craze going on nowadays, and will follow 'The Inches EP' - a series of self-produced music videos one of which - 'Nothing Is Easy' - was nominated for an honour at the Limelight Short Film Awards in London. 

'No More Years' will be released on February 24th next, which is also the date at which pre-sale begins for the full length record.

Speaking of the video, Tony told us at entertainment.ie: "It's a zero budget, blatant metaphor. With a couple of sci-fi fantasy nods in there, as I am a proud nerd. Also poking a bit of fun at all those singer songwriter vids in the woods. However, I do hold up my mucky hands, I've been guilty of doing those too. I'll probably do them again…"
